Output 816dbc773eafa1b40416617c0d867113293da76e6eaac84b3aac790aeddc1788:55

value
369451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8359be6e31ca961fd485e7573537079e3bd080c0 OP_EQUAL
address
3DfXxBnsttMvsbP3faMuUDEYjkLHv7ceGc
transaction
816dbc773eafa1b40416617c0d867113293da76e6eaac84b3aac790aeddc1788
spent
true